Re: Adds padding between Hairpins and SpanBars. (issue 5438060)

Carl . D . Sorensen
Re: Adds padding between Hairpins and SpanBars. (issue 5438060)
Mon, 28 Nov 2011 01:24:34 +0000

Looks pretty good.  Thanks for hitting this so quickly.  Just a couple
of stylistic comments.


File lily/include/system.hh (right):
lily/include/system.hh:45: Grob * get_neighboring_staff (Direction dir,
Grob *vag);
*vag should be *vertical_axis_group for clarity in the header file, IMO.

In the engraver, the code that defines vag shows it to be a
vertical_axis_group, so I'm ok with it there.
File lily/ (right):
lily/ System::get_neighboring_staff (Direction dir, Grob
Here, *vag should be *vertical_axis_group because there is no context
for understanding what it means.
File scm/define-grob-properties.scm (right):
scm/define-grob-properties.scm:1047: (has-span-bar ,pair? "A pair of
span bars indicating whether a a span bar
"A pair of grobs containing the span bars to be drawn above and below
the staff.  If no span bar is in a position, the respective element is
set to @code{#f}."

Is this a correct statement?  If so, I think it's clearer than the
current wording.

